Lee James Blanchard was born on April 1, 1924, to Joel and Elise Guidry Blanchard in Parks, La
Lee passed away peacefully on Tuesday, March 2, 2021, at 9:55 a.m. with his two sons at his side.
Lee Blanchard graduated from St. Bernard Catholic School, and briefly attended Spenser School of Business before enlisting in the Army in the Fall of 1942. He was commissioned as a second lieutenant in the ARMY AIR CORP and attend several training schools becoming proficient as a fighter pilot specializing in P47’s. He was last stationed in Hawaii before being discharged in the Summer of 1946. He attended SLI under the GI Bill and graduated in 1950 with a BS in Mechanical Engineering. He worked in the oil field industry in South Louisiana employed by Superior Oil Co for 30 years. He retired in 1995 after 45 years of work in his technical field. He spent his retirement years traveling to Colorado with Odette, working weekends on both the Blanchard and Gondron farms, and most recently as a skilled woodworker building furniture for his children and grandchildren. His segmented bowls were well respected for their quality and complex design. His last years were spent on the Blanchard family farm near Parks, working in his woodshop and sharing time with his two boys and their families.
